Reversible hyperintensity lesion on diffusion-weighted MRI in hypoglycemic coma

In a woman aged 73 years who recovered from hypoglycemic coma without neurologic deficit after glucose infusion, admission diffusion-weighted MRI showed the presence of hyperintensive lesions. The lesions regressed after glucose infusion.
